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Elvis Presley's "When the Saints Go Marching In" explore themes of redemption, salvation, and the desire to be reunited with loved ones in a new and better world. The song begins by acknowledging the footsteps of those who've gone before us and the hope for a reunion on a new sunlit shore. This idea of being with loved ones again is repeated throughout the song, with the desire to be part of the number of saints marching in.


The song acknowledges that this world can be full of trouble, but looks forward to a morning when a new world is revealed. This is a reference to the biblical Book of Revelation, which predicts a new world where the righteous will be rewarded and the wicked punished. The song continues with references to other positive changes, such as when the rich go out to work, the air is pure and clean, and leaders learn to cry. These verses suggest a longing for societal and environmental changes that would benefit all people.


In summary, "When the Saints Go Marching In" is a song that expresses a desire for salvation and reunion with loved ones in a new, better world. It also touches on hopes for positive societal changes that would benefit everyone.
